CRIMES ACT 1900 - SECT 48
Causing explosives to be placed in or near building, conveyance or public place
48 Causing explosives to be placed in or near building, conveyance or public
place
(1) A person who causes an explosive to be placed in or near: (a) a building,
or
(b) a vehicle, vessel, train or other conveyance, or
(c) a public place,
with the intention of causing bodily harm to any person, is guilty of an
offence. Maximum penalty: Imprisonment for 14 years.
(2) A person commits an
offence under this section whether or not: (a) any explosion occurs, or
(b)
any bodily harm is caused.
